Calculating the price of a commercial vehicle wrap can seem daunting, but understanding the factors that influence the final bill can help you budget. Generally, a full vehicle can range from around $3,000 to $6,000, depending on elements.

  • Vehicle size plays a major influence: Larger vehicles naturally require more material, driving up the price.
  • How complex the design is impacts the labor involved. Intricate designs often mean more hours, which affects the overall price.
  • Resolution and print quality also varies, with higher detail prints typically costing higher prices.

Don't forget to factor in additional fees like application labor and any needed prep on the vehicle before wrapping.

Determining Aspects Influencing Commercial Vehicle Wrap Pricing

Vehicle wraps can be a major investment for businesses looking to boost brand recognition.

The cost of a commercial vehicle wrap can differ based on a amount of elements. Some of the primary factors that affect pricing include the size of the unit, the complexity of the design, the type of material used, and the expertise of the installer.

Additional factors that can affect pricing include the location where the wrap is placed, the quantity of vehicles being wrapped, and any extra services required, such as graphic creation.

It's important to receive quotes from multiple vendors to evaluate pricing and options before making a selection.

Maximize Your ROI: The True Cost concerning a Commercial Vehicle Wrap

Investing in a commercial vehicle wrap is a strategic move that can dramatically boost your brand visibility and generate significant return on investment (ROI). However, it's crucial to understand the true cost associated with this decision. While the initial sticker price might seem attractive, several factors impact the overall expense. here

Firstly, consider the quality with materials used in the wrap. Premium vinyl provides superior durability, color preservation, and resistance to fading, ensuring a long-lasting presentation. Secondly, factor in the complexity for the design. Intricate graphics and custom elements often require more time and expertise from skilled designers and installers, increasing the cost.

Furthermore, the size and type of your vehicle will also affect the wrap's price. Larger vehicles with detailed contours typically require more material and labor, resulting in a higher investment. Don't ignore the importance of professional installation as well. A poorly installed wrap can lead to air bubbles, peeling, and overall aesthetic issues, ultimately diminishing your ROI.

  • Consider obtaining quotes from multiple reputable wrapping companies to compare prices and services.
  • Request detailed breakdowns of costs, including materials, labor, and any additional fees.
  • Factor in the long-term benefits of a high-quality wrap, such as increased brand awareness and customer engagement.
